Hi All

Can someone suggest solution to my problem on export to excel

For my entire report I see 1 row data and then 2-3 empty rows.

Although no data is missing , its just that i want to avoid those empty rows.

Here is what my formatting looks like.
I have data in Header A , Header B, Page Header A , page Header B, group header is suppressed, Details is suppressed and then data in Group Footer A. Page footer and report footer also suppress.

How ever this doesn't happen when i export to data only excel option.

You need to select all objects in the row->right click->make same size->height. Also just above that, choose align->bottoms. Then attach all to a vertical guideline and move them to the top of the section. Then bring up the bottom of the section to nest against the bottom of the fields. If you want to eliminate columns between data, attach each field to horizontal guidelines on both sides, and attach neighboring fields to the same guideline.
